Chopard Imperiale Steel Diamond Watch

Sale price€8.500,00

Watch signed by Chopard, Impériale model, in stainless steel, bezel set with 37 brilliant-cut diamonds, for a total of approximately 1.17 carats, folding clasp, silver dial with mother-of-pearl center, set on the crown with an amethyst of approximately 0.06 ct, wrist circumference: 19 cm, bracelet width: 1.8 cm,
Quartz movement, recently serviced. Signed and numbered. Good condition.
Case size 36 mm,
Total weight: 94.58 g.
New price: €15,700
Reference: 1176768CN

Louis-Ulysse Chopard established his high-precision watchmaking factory in the Swiss Jura region in 1860. He started with high-quality pocket watches, earning him the support of Tsar Nicholas II. The 1960s and its acquisition by a German goldsmith marked a turning point for the company. In 1976, the innovative Happy Diamonds watch collection was launched, featuring mobile diamonds integrated into the dial. Chopard subsequently diversified into luxury jewelry and sports watches. Maison Chopard was founded by a watchmaking artisan. Purchased and developed by another family of jewelers and watchmakers, the Scheufele family, they diversified in the 1970s by launching jewelry watches.
